Scientists have monitored the emergence of a new derivative of the mutant Omicron in some European countries and the United States, which spreads more quickly and does not appear in the analysis of the Corona virus smear.
The American magazine Scientist quoted Cameron Wolfe, an expert in infectious diseases at Duke University School of Medicine, as saying: “What was recently detected is a new version of the Omicron mutant called (PA2), explaining that the inability of the analyzes to detect it made scientists call it the name (Omicron invisibility).
Wolf described O'Mikron and its new derivative as brothers from the same family, where there are slight differences, but most of the genes are similar.
In turn, scientists in India documented some differences between the omicron mutant and the derived mutant (PA2), as there is a slight difference in the shape of the protein, while Gabriel Leung, dean of the Faculty of Medicine at the University of Hong Kong, suggested that the new mutant omicron derivative may spread 35 percent faster than the original mutant.
It is noteworthy that although the Omicron mutant does not cause serious symptoms that require hospitalization, it has more than 30 mutations in the spinal protein on the surface of the virus, which gave it the ability to deprive the effectiveness of vaccines.
Earlier, WHO officials said: “The new mutant of the Corona virus that will draw the world’s attention will be more contagious than Omicron, but what scientists really need to answer is whether it will be more deadly or not.
